We deliver a raw, unfiltered message about authenticity and misplaced priorities in youth culture. From basketball debates to harsh truth about seeking peer approval, we challenge listeners to think independently and pursue meaningful growth instead of chasing superficial validation.
• Could you beat professional athletes like LeBron James or tackle Marshawn Lynch?
• Critical analysis of 90s basketball era and skill levels compared to today
• Harsh truths about glamorizing violence, guns, and bullying
• Why chasing "coolness" in school leads nowhere in adult life
• The importance of discovering your true identity instead of following others
• How seeking male approval rather than pursuing genuine interests reflects insecurity
• Prioritizing personal growth, education and character development over materialistic pursuits
If you made it through this episode without taking it personally, you've got what it takes to hear the truth and do something about it.
